Mingjuan Tang is a scholar working on Molecular Biology, Plant Science and Ecology, Evolution, Behavior and Systematics. According to data from OpenAlex, Mingjuan Tang has authored 12 papers receiving a total of 508 indexed citations (citations by other indexed papers that have themselves been cited), including 10 papers in Molecular Biology, 10 papers in Plant Science and 2 papers in Ecology, Evolution, Behavior and Systematics. Recurrent topics in Mingjuan Tang’s work include Plant Molecular Biology Research (6 papers), Plant Stress Responses and Tolerance (5 papers) and Plant Gene Expression Analysis (4 papers). Mingjuan Tang is often cited by papers focused on Plant Molecular Biology Research (6 papers), Plant Stress Responses and Tolerance (5 papers) and Plant Gene Expression Analysis (4 papers). Mingjuan Tang collaborates with scholars based in China, United States and Canada. Mingjuan Tang's co-authors include Shihua Shen, Yu Liang, Jingwen Sun, Shihua Shen, Yun Liu, Hui Chen, Xiaofei Liu, Fan Chen, Huaping Deng and Pingfang Yang and has published in prestigious journals such as Journal of Experimental Botany, Gene and PLoS Genetics.
